Undergraduate Health Professions Degrees at Southeastern Community College - Whiteville

Here is each degree level available for health professions at Southeastern Community College - Whiteville,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.

Degree Level Annual Graduates
Associate’s 40
Undergraduate Certificate 18
Certificate 73

Health Professions Majors at Southeastern Community College - Whiteville

The health professions area of study at Southeastern Community College - Whiteville covers the following majors. Select a major to see its rankings, popularity, salary, and diversity details:

Major Annual Graduates
Clinical/Medical Laboratory Science/Research and Allied Professions 53
Health and Medical Administrative Services 36
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, Nursing Research and Clinical Nursing 24
Practical Nursing, Vocational Nursing and Nursing Assistants 18

Southeastern Community College - Whiteville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

$2,600 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)
$10,188 Average Student Debt

Average full-time tuition and fees are listed in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$2,432 $8,576
Fees $168 $168
